    Made this on a whim after a vegetable share box included chard and potatoes. It was really tasty and nicely light with the peas, but I was very glad to have read paulabee's comment first. Like hers, my potatoes took 25 minutes or so in the coconut broth (with added water to accommodate the cook time) to get even remotely close to the point that they would finish cooking with the remaining ten minute cook time. Otherwise, the only change I made was not to defrost the peas (no frozen pea needs to be defrosted ever, and certainly not if you are expecting to cook them for 5 minutes, as here).

    This was good! It's relatively mild, but I served it with a more assertively spiced paneer dish so these went well together. It's a lovely use of summer produce when you still want something warming and hearty (without being heavy). I thought the chard was great here but I could likewise imagine tossing in whatever greens I had on hand. A note--as is often the case in MS's recipes, the written potato cook time feels much too short; she says 10 minutes and then you're adding the coconut broth and putting in the chard stems after that. I cooked the potatoes until they were actually soft in the coconut broth before adding to the chard stems and I'm glad I did (otherwise I would have cooked the chard to oblivion I think); potatoes took about 25 minutes, then chard stems for five, then another five with leaves to finish. My potatoes held their shape and weren't overdone at all.
